Learn more about Prodigy: https://cem.com/prodigy The Prodigy™ is a game-changing preparative HPLC system designed to optimize your peptide purification process. Featuring a fully integrated heating system, the Prodigy™ allows you to perform chromatographic methods from the analytical scale directly at the preparative scale, enabling improved performance and efficiency. With its ability to access elevated temperatures, the Prodigy™ enhances peptide purification, reduces fraction sizes, and ensures higher yields in less time. Key Features: Integrated Heating System: Access elevated temperatures for better chromatographic performance and faster peptide purification. Reduced Fractions: Built-in focused gradient methods help reduce the number of fractions collected, increasing purity and simplifying downstream processing. UV-Directed Fraction Collection: Ensure precise and accurate fraction collection with UV monitoring for targeted peptide isolation. Intuitive Touchscreen Interface: Easy-to-use software that makes controlling and monitoring your purification process simpler than ever. Flow Rates Up to 250 mL/min: High flow rates enable efficient large-scale purification with excellent resolution.
